I am going to add images into a tag. How will it resize itself in adobe flex actionscript? : adobe flex action script

Answer Posted / Jyoti Shukla

In Adobe Flex, when you add an image to a container, the container doesn't automatically resize itself to fit the image. However, you can use various methods to resize the image and its container. One common approach is to set the `scaleMode` property of the image component or set the width and height properties of the container. Here's an example:

```actionscript
<s:HBox id="myContainer">
<s:Image id="myImage" source="your_image_source"/>
</s:HBox>

myContainer.scaleMode = "noScale";
myContainer.percentWidth = 100;
myContainer.percentHeight = 100;
```
